ByteDance

Linux Kernel Performance Architect

ByteDance

San Jose, CA, USA
Full-TimeDepends on ExperienceSenior LevelMasters
Job Description

Are you a passionate Linux enthusiast with a strong understanding of performance optimization? Do you have a knack for identifying bottlenecks and implementing solutions to enhance system efficiency? If so, ByteDance is looking for a talented Linux Kernel Performance Architect to join our dynamic team.In this role, you will work closely with our engineering and operations teams to analyze and improve the performance of our Linux-based systems. Your expertise in kernel tuning, hardware configuration, and system profiling will play a crucial role in ensuring the smooth and efficient operation of our platforms. We are seeking a self-motivated individual with excellent problem-solving skills, a keen eye for detail, and a drive to continuously improve and innovate.If you are ready to take on new challenges and make a significant impact in a fast-paced and rapidly growing company, we encourage you to apply for this exciting opportunity.

  1. Analyze and optimize the performance of Linux-based systems.
  2. Collaborate with engineering and operations teams to identify and resolve system bottlenecks.
  3. Utilize expertise in kernel tuning, hardware configuration, and system profiling to improve system efficiency.
  4. Continuously monitor and evaluate system performance to identify areas for improvement.
  5. Develop and implement solutions to enhance system performance and scalability.
  6. Conduct system tests and benchmarks to measure and validate performance improvements.
  7. Stay up-to-date with industry developments and trends in Linux performance optimization.
  8. Communicate performance findings and recommendations to relevant teams and stakeholders.
  9. Troubleshoot and resolve performance issues in a timely manner.
  10. Take ownership of performance-related projects and drive them to completion.
  11. Act as a mentor to junior team members and provide guidance on performance optimization techniques.
  12. Collaborate with cross-functional teams to ensure performance considerations are incorporated into the design and development of new systems.
  13. Continuously strive to improve and innovate processes and tools related to performance optimization.
  14. Adhere to company policies and procedures, including security and compliance standards.
  15. Keep accurate records and documentation of performance optimizations and changes made to systems.
Where is this job?
This job is located at San Jose, CA, USA
Job Qualifications
  • Extensive Experience With Linux Kernel Development And Performance Tuning.

  • Strong Understanding Of System Architecture And Hardware Components.

  • Proficiency In Programming Languages Such As C And Assembly.

  • Knowledge Of Performance Monitoring And Debugging Tools.

  • Familiarity With Various Linux Distributions And Their Performance Differences.

Required Skills
  • Virtualization

  • Debugging

  • Resource management

  • Memory management

  • Performance analysis

  • Device Drivers

  • System Tuning

  • Cache

  • Kernel Optimization

  • I/O Optimization

  • Kernel Profiling

  • Cpu Scheduling

Soft Skills
  • Communication

  • Conflict Resolution

  • Emotional Intelligence

  • Leadership

  • Time management

  • creativity

  • Teamwork

  • Adaptability

  • Problem-Solving

  • Decision-making

Compensation

According to JobzMall, the average salary range for a Linux Kernel Performance Architect in San Jose, CA, USA is between $150,000 and $200,000 per year. This may vary depending on factors such as experience, skills, and the specific company and industry the architect is working in. Some companies may offer higher salaries or additional benefits such as bonuses, stock options, and other incentives.

Additional Information
ByteDance is an Equal Opportunity Employer. We celebrate diversity and are committed to creating an inclusive environment for all employees. We do not discriminate based upon race, religion, color, national origin, sex, sexual orientation, gender identity, age, status as a protected veteran, status as an individual with a disability, or other applicable legally protected characteristics.
Required LanguagesEnglish
Job PostedJuly 16th, 2024
Apply BeforeMay 22nd, 2025
This job posting is from a verified source. 
Reposted

Apply with Video Cover Letter Add a warm greeting to your application and stand out!

About ByteDance

ByteDance is a technology company operating a range of content platforms that inform, educate, entertain and inspire people across languages, cultures, and geographies. Dedicated to building global platforms of creation and interaction, ByteDance now has a portfolio of applications available in over 150 markets and 75 languages. For example, TikTok, Helo, Vigo Video, Douyin, and Huoshan.

Frequently asked questions

Get interviewed today!

JobzMall is the world‘ s largest video talent marketplace.It‘s ultrafast, fun, and human.

Get Started